Argh.  I have a P6-200 with 2 DEC DE500-AA's (-AC part num), replacing
an SMC card that I was having problems with.

My system boots through netstart, gets to "add net default", then
craps out with a "Enabling 100baseTX port", and de1: Enabling...

Then craps out with an NMI, and drops into the debugger with a "Trap type
19", code=0.

Stopped at "tulip_delay_300ns+0x17".



Has anybody ported the updated de0 driver to -RELEASE?

Any tips appreciated.
